使用Python处理字符串。

简介: 使用Python处理字符串。

字符串是Python的一种常用的数据类型。在Python中,字符串由两个引号括起。

例如"string" , 'string'

下面整理一些对字符串的常用操作:

修改单词的大小写: title() 首字母大写, upper()所有字母大写,  lower()所有字母小写

拼接字符串: 在两(n)个字符串之间使用 + 可以将它们连接起来

删除空白: 删除字符串尾部空格 rstrip() ,注意如果要永久删除空格,要将rstrip()的结果赋值给变量。

               删除开头的空格 lstrip()

               删除两端的空格 strip()

转义字符:换行\n, 制表符\t,

学习了列表以后,我们可以用切片截取字符串的部分。

如: str1 = "a string with space "

 str2 = str1[0:8] 这样就截取了str1的前8个字母,(对汉字同样有效)。

学习了for循环和if条件后,我们可以利用for遍历字符串然后用if设置条件,对字符串进行更多的处理。

关键字 in 是一个常用的语句,可以用来判断字符串是否包含我们想要的东西。

相关文章
|
5天前
|
算法框架/工具 索引 Python
Python基础教程(第3版)中文版 第三章 使用字符串(笔记)
Python基础教程(第3版)中文版 第三章 使用字符串(笔记)
|
18天前
|
索引 Python
Python中的字符串格式化:详解与应用
Python中的字符串格式化:详解与应用
17 0
|
3天前
|
Python 索引
【Python字符串攻略】:玩转文字,编织程序的叙事艺术
【Python字符串攻略】:玩转文字,编织程序的叙事艺术
|
3天前
|
Python
刷题——Python篇(3)字符串
刷题——Python篇(3)字符串
|
4天前
|
索引 Python
Python零基础入门-2 数字、字符串和列表
Python零基础入门-2 数字、字符串和列表
|
6天前
|
Python
Python使用正则表达式分割字符串
在Python中,你可以使用re模块的split()函数来根据正则表达式分割字符串。这个函数的工作原理类似于Python内置的str.split()方法,但它允许你使用正则表达式作为分隔符。
|
8天前
|
存储 算法 数据挖掘
LeetCode 题目 43:字符串相乘 多种算法分析对比 【python】
LeetCode 题目 43:字符串相乘 多种算法分析对比 【python】
|
8天前
|
SQL 算法 数据可视化
LeetCode第八题:字符串转换整数 (atoi)【8/1000 python】
LeetCode第八题:字符串转换整数 (atoi)【8/1000 python】
|
11天前
|
存储 Python
Python字符串魔力:打造高效进销存系统的利器
Python字符串魔力:打造高效进销存系统的利器
|
11天前
|
XML 数据采集 自然语言处理
掌握Python字符串:全面解析与实战指南
掌握Python字符串:全面解析与实战指南